Well, there's a races called "Claiming Races" You enter your horse in the race. And if people want that racehorse they drop a note that says, "I claim 'this horse' And they'll shake it and whoever's name is pulled out, it's the person who claims it. They give a price for each horse for like $25,000 and the people at the track claim the horse before the race is run. You don't have to claim a horse though.

Large races like the Kentucky Derby allows 20 horses. The average number for smaller races is 8 to 10 horses.
